The Nokia N78 also has an A-GPS, the N78 is has an integrated 3-month navigation license and free Nokia Maps with up to 15 million global points of interest. The Nokia N78 features geotagging, which merges 3.2 megapixel camera with Carl Zeiss optics functionality and A-GPS to create a personal GPS map, as well as share with your friends the pictures taken there.
At 102 grams, the device stands at middleweight with 113x29x15mm with quad-band connectivity (850/900/1800/1900 MHz) and packs a HSDPA 3.5G. The device also comes with Wi-Fi, Bluetooth with A2DP support.
The N78 also comes with an integrated FM transmitter, which allows users to broadcast their own playlists to any FM receiver or stereo system. The phone’s N78 supports microSD cards up to 8GB. The Nokia N78 is compatible with internet service such as Share on Ovi, Flickr or VOX blogs that enable consumers to create content right on their phones.

The N78 is expected to retail for RM 1,950 and will be available in two colours- cocoa brown and lagoon blue.
